Had the same issue on my Surface pro. Was browsing on the internet and saw something about GPU and Surface Pro. Information was shared that the Surface Pro cannot handle the GPU request as GPU isn't sufficient enough. When I disabled GPU usage for Teams, it was performing a lot better, but still not as it should be.
I recently upgraded to a Dell 7300 (company policy, my wish was to upgrade to Surface Book 3), and Teams is performing a lot better!
Just to make sure it has something to do with the Teams client, did you tried the Teams Web client?Let me know the outcome on using the web client, and maybe switching off GPU usage is working for you as well 🙂
